Plants Vs Zombies War
Plants Vs Zombies War is based on the famous PC game called Plants VS Zombies. This tower-defense strategy game needs your plans to fight against 15 kinds of incoming zombies. You can check the consumption and attack of all of your 15 plants before the battle. Then the tutorial will show the basic rules and plants at Level 1. The more levels you complete, the more plants you can unlock. You could also unlock them from ads in advance.
